👣 Strong arches = strong outer hips = better balance.
And one of the simplest ways to build stronger arches is with a movement I teach in nearly every beginner series and private session:
This movement strengthens the intrinsic muscles of your feet and wakes up the deep stabilizers in your hips — especially your glute medius, which plays a huge role in balance, walking, and hiking.
Builds awareness of how your feet interact with the ground
Activates the muscles that create a strong arch
Preps your hips to support you better in standing & balance poses
Helps reduce foot fatigue and improve alignment from the ground up
Whether you’re working on Warrior III, trying to feel more stable in daily life, or just want to stop gripping with your toes — this is your move.
